Are You Missing the Big Picture or Getting Lost in the Details?

As a business owner or leader, have you ever felt like you're either drowning in the details or missing out on the grand vision?


This is a common struggle, especially in smaller businesses where you juggle both strategic and operational roles. Finding the right balance can be tough, but it’s essential for success.


Working with boards, and mentoring some who works with boards, too often I noticed that board members focus on the nitty-gritty details, getting bogged down in operations instead of steering the company strategically. While it’s important to understand the operations, the real value of a board lies in its ability to see the bigger picture and set the direction for the future. Operational managers are there to handle the day-to-day tasks—it's what they excel at.



The Balancing Act for Small Business Owners

In small businesses, you wear multiple hats. One moment you're strategising about future growth, and the next, you're dealing with operational issues. It’s easy to get stuck in one mode:


  • Big Picture Focus: You have grand visions and ambitious goals, but without attention to detail, plans can fall apart. Important tasks may be over-looked, leading to operational hiccups.

  • Detail Focus: You’re on top of every task, ensuring everything runs smoothly. However, you might miss out on growth opportunities and strategic shifts that could propel your business forward.
